I am not asking for registration keys. I myself have three unused keys to give out in fact.

What I am talking about are the entries found using regedit. Particularly in H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Valve\Steam\Apps\230230.

The issue is that every time I try to run D:OS it futilely tries for about 5 minutes to install some .Net framework (I think its 3.5). This is really annoying, and I know from experience with other games, notably Sacred 2, that Steam, once success, will place a DWORD into your registry that prevents further checks. Unfortunately, I don't know what that key is.

So if someone could tell me what keys are in normally H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Valve\Steam\Apps\230230 I should be able to fix this issue.
